By 2020, quantum computing had moved from purely theoretical models to the deployment of noisy intermediate‑scale quantum (NISQ) devices. Simultaneously, deep learning and large‑scale language models (LLMs) had demonstrated unprecedented capabilities across natural language processing, computer vision, and drug discovery. Researchers quickly recognized that quantum algorithms—particularly variational quantum eigensolvers (VQEs) and quantum approximate optimization algorithms (QAOAs)—could accelerate certain subroutines within AI pipelines, such as sampling from complex probability distributions or optimizing high‑dimensional loss landscapes. juq-326
